Ring of Authority Rating

Ring of Authority is recommended for characters with high Attack. The higher the Attack, the stronger the Barrier generated after Guts activates, making the character harder to KO. The key advantage is that unlike Immortality or Revive, it activates even while Souldeath is applied.

Also Excellent as a Counter to HP Alteration and Chain Activations

Ring of Authority prevents characters from being KO'd in one hit by HP Alteration characters like Freyja or Randgrid. It also prevents low-durability characters from being KO'd in one hit and triggering chain activation skills from characters like Lu Bu.

Also Useful in PvE

It can prevent a character from being KO'd once by enemies, and since the skill queue is maintained, it is useful not only in PvP but also in PvE. Damage-focused rings tend to score higher, but Ring of Authority is also an option when you want stability.

Comparison of Ring of Authority and Rings in the Same Category

Uncommon Ring of AuthorityRing of AuthorityGuts; after Guts activates, generate a Barrier equal to ●% of Attack for 2 turns
(Does not stack with Hero passives)
[★6] 150% / [★5] 75% / [★4] 30%
Uncommon Ring of ResurrectionRing of ResurrectionWhen KO'd, Revive once with ●% HP
(Does not stack with Hero passives)
[★6] 100% / [★5] 50% / [★4] 25%
Uncommon Ring of ImmortalityRing of ImmortalityWhen KO'd, enter Immortality state for ● turn(s)
(Does not stack with Hero passives)
[★6] 3 turns / [★5] 2 turns / [★4] 1 turn

In general, Ring of Resurrection is recommended for characters with high Max HP or durability, Ring of Immortality is recommended for low-durability characters you want to keep on the field longer, and Ring of Authority is recommended for characters with high Attack.

Recommended Heroes for Ring of Authority

Lu Bu, Freyja, and More

The Ring of Authority is best for high-attack heroes like Lu Bu and Freyja. In Real Time Arena, equipping it on low-durability heroes like Kagura to counter repeated skill activations is also effective.

Be Aware of Heroes Not Recommended for Ring of Authority

If a hero whose Passive Skill grants Guts equips the Ring of Authority, only the stronger of the two effects will activate. If that hero also has an on-Guts effect, it may fail to trigger. Avoid equipping the ring on the heroes listed above.

Recommended Refining and Crafting for Ring of Authority

Ring of Resurrection or Ring of Immortality Recommended

For Ring of Authority's Fixed Refinement, Ring of Resurrection or Ring of Immortality is recommended. If you plan to equip it on a durability-focused or Support hero, Ring of Resurrection works well; for Attackers, Ring of Immortality is often the better choice.

Ring of Roar Is Also Useful

Ring of Authority is most effective on heroes with high Attack, making Ring of Roar — which generates Barrier based on Attack — a great pairing. If Refinement with a Legendary ring is difficult, this is the recommended alternative.

Random Conversion requires fewer materials

Fixed Conversion lets you obtain a specific ring, but requires more material rings. With Random Conversion, the ring obtained is random but requires fewer materials, so Random Conversion is recommended unless you are targeting a specific ring.

Drops from Adventure Nightmare

Accessory Rank by Area

Nightmare StageDropped Accessory
1-1~★4
6-1~★4~★5
11-1~★4~★6

Accessories have a chance to drop when you clear Adventure Nightmare stages. Nightmare becomes available after clearing Adventure 14-50, and the rank of dropped accessories increases as you advance through stages.

Nightmare uses a 2-round format that requires 2 parties. By including Mog or Doo in one of your parties, you can boost the accessory drop rate.

GameWithPoint!Doo can be obtained through Pet Conversion. Mog and Doo's effects do not stack, so only bring one of them.

Guaranteed Legendary Accessory Drop on the 15,000th Clear

1-en

If you clear Nightmare stages 15,000 times without a single Legendary accessory dropping, a Legendary accessory is guaranteed to drop. The road is long, but don't give up — keep grinding even if luck isn't on your side.

Infinite Tower Rewards

2-en

Clearing Floor 250 and 290 of the Infinite Tower rewards a ★4 Legendary Accessory Box, and clearing Floor 350 rewards a ★5 Legendary Accessory Box. It takes effort, but work your way up floor by floor to claim the rewards.

Exchange at Arena Shop

3-en

You can exchange for a ★4 Legendary Accessory Box at the Arena content shop. The Winner's Medal cost is high, but it is one of the highest-priority items to exchange for in the Arena Shop.

Exchange at Total War Shop

4-en

The Total War exchange shop offers ★4–★6 Rare or Legendary Accessory Boxes. Collecting advanced Total War Coins is demanding, but opportunities to obtain ★6 Legendary rings are limited, so it is recommended to save up 2,500 and exchange.

★6 Legendary Rings Can Be Converted to a Different Type

7-en

★6 Legendary rings can be converted into a ★6 Legendary Accessory Selection Box once per month. Use this feature if you didn't get the ★6 Legendary ring you wanted.
